About my practice: As a marriage and family therapist, I use a relational approach with clients – one that focuses on how my clients relate to others, as well as themselves. I work with clients to set clear goals, and then identify and change patterns that may be currently preventing them from thriving in healthy relationships. My training in creative arts therapy allows me to also offer my clients of any age the opportunity to express themselves in other ways, beyond verbal communication.
